Gas Chromatography Line Expanded
Jul 25 2013
Baseline (USA) have announced the release of their new state of the art Gas Chromatograph. The 9100 Series Online Gas Chromatograph is designed to continuously monitor and analyse pollutants such as BTEX, Naphthalene and other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s). Whether complying with EPA regulations, monitoring outdoor air quality, fence lines or remediation sites, the 9100 Series offers accurate and repeatable results.
Being microprocessor based and containing embedded firmware and software, the 9100 Series eliminates need for an external PC connection. The icon based touchscreen allows for easy operation, setup and data presentation, all remotely accessible via network connection making it ideal for unattended operation. With automatic calibration, multi-point sampling, an expanded range of output choices (LAN, RS232, multiple 4-20 mA or 0-20 mA) and a variety of programmable relay functions for alarms, diagnostics or other timed events, the Series 9100 offers a great deal of flexibility.
Other applications for the 9100 Series include Exposure to Toxic Gases, Impurities in Specialty, Industrial and Beverage Gases as well as Fast C1 to C5 Mudlogging during Oil and Gas Exploration.
